CVE-2025-3625
7.1 HIGH
- CVSS version: 3.1
- Attack vector (AV): NETWORK
- Attack complexity (AC): LOW
- Privileges required (PR): LOW
- User interaction (UI): NONE
- Scope (S): UNCHANGED
- Confidentiality impact (C): LOW
- Integrity impact (I): NONE
- Availability impact (A): HIGH
Moodle: user dos and name disclosure via idor in moodle mfa email factor revoke action
A security vulnerability was discovered in Moodle that can allow hackers to gain access to sensitive information about students and prevent them from logging into their accounts, even after they had completed two-factor authentication (2FA).
